Our Client has a requirement for a Procurment Coordinator, who will be required to work on a contract basis in London or Milton Keynes.

Role Purpose:

-The issuance and follow-up of orders in accordance with the needs expressed by the requestor.
- Ensure the follow-up of quotes and negotiation of non-strategic purchases.
- Coordinate invoicing follow-up.

Job Role Responsibilities:

- Receive and analyze procurement needs.
- Request quotes and negotiate with suppliers for non-strategic categories in accordance with the delegation procedure.
- Register and create new suppliers.
- Issue orders within the scope and ensure their follow-up, including the issuance of amendments if necessary (in coordination with Buyer).
- Enter data into dedicated Purchasing management databases/tools: Document tracking and internal approval management, ERP (order creation and commitment tracking at the accounting level and validation of invoices), or other external platforms.
- Ensure the interface with requestors and internal stakeholders (Requesting Services, Management Control, Accounting, Support Tools, GBS, and other entities of the group), or external stakeholders (suppliers if applicable).
- Manage and monitor the approval flow of Purchasing deliverables (Orders, invoices, etc.).
- Ensure the coordination and monitoring of GBS India's invoicing performance in accordance with the contractual conditions of the orders.
- In collaboration with the Requestor and Buyer in charge, and at their request, settle disputes related to the administrative management of orders with internal or external suppliers.
- Participate in the creation and implementation of procedures and processes and their continuous improvement.
- Participate in the development and support of performance indicators (KPIs), monitoring tables, statistics/activity reports of the Service, and decision support formats for this purchasing family.

Experience / Skills / Knowledge / Qualifications:

-Entry level procurement background and/or administrative background

-Technical diploma or relevant degree/ diploma

-Negotiation and listening skills
